The '''Russian Orthodox Church of Russia''', also referred to as the '''Moscow Patriarchate'''(another official name), is one of the [[autocephalous]] Orthodox churches, ranking fifth after [[Church of Constantinople|Constantinople]], [[Church of Alexandria|Alexandria]], [[Church of Antioch|Antioch]], and [[Church of Jerusalem|Jerusalem]]. It exercises [[jurisdiction]] over Orthodox Christians in Russia and the surrounding Slavic lands as well as [[exarchate]]s and patriarchal representation churches around the world. It also exercises jurisdiction over the autonomous [[Church of Japan]] and Orthodox Christians in China. The most recent Patriarch of Moscow and All Russia was His Holiness [[Alexei II (Ridiger) of Moscow|Alexei II]] until his death in 2008.
